  • Abstract
    Sudden Cardiac Death (SCD) is an important risk factor for primary Ventricular Fibrillation (VF). This paper presents a prediction algorithm of VF based on Cloud-Mobile Healthcare platform. This algorithm applies heart rate variability (HRV) features and neural fuzzy network. The neural fuzzy network´s input features are obtained by linear and nonlinear features of HRV. The experimental results show that the combination of features can predict VF by the accuracy of 65% for the five minutes intervals, before VF occurrence. It has been implemented in Cloud-Mobile Healthcare Platform. This Cloud-Mobile Healthcare Platform meets heart patient´s requirements of early detection of outside the hospital.
